Jacqueline Fernandez launches The Body Shop Oils of Life

The Body Shop launches 3 New Ranges inspired by Finest ingredients from around the world with JACQUELINE FERNANDEZ
Unveiling the new beauty rituals of SKIN.SPA.SCENT
Savita Kaushim Dhami, Marketing Head, Jacqueline Fernandez, Aradhika Mehta, National Manager Training and Shikhi Agarwal, Head Training - The Body Shop India

Mumbai, Friday 4th December, 2015: The Body Shop, UK’s iconic retailer of cosmetics and toiletries along with the dynamic brand ambassador Jacqueline Fernandez, unveiled new SKIN.SPA.SCENT beauty rituals with the naturally infused products ranges; OILS OF LIFE, SPA OF THE WORLD & NEW VOYAGE COLLECTION. The launch showcased The Body Shop’s expertise in exploring traditional cultures in faraway destinations, the combination of ancient beauty rituals, perfected by centuries of wisdom.
The intensely revitalising skincare range Oils of Life, is an expert blend of three exceptional seed oils, known for their supreme abilities to repair and revitalise skin. Sourced from the three continents Egypt, Chile and China, the most precious and potent natural seed oils known since ancient times for their richness in essential nutrients and supreme restoring properties is part of the new daily life-infusing skincare range to revitalise skin, replenish nutrition, revive radiance and visibly reduce signs of ageing.

The Body Shop’s new body care range, Spa of the World™ alters your bathroom into the greatest spa on earth. Perfected by centuries of wisdom, it discovers the finest natural ingredients, refined textures and delicate fragrances, from purifying and firming clays, sensorial and luxury oils, refining natural scrubs and decadent creams. It’s the perfect indulgence imbibing the finest, natural ingredients from around the world.

HATE STORY 3 (Movie review)

Rating: ***

An erotic revenge thriller, a third installment of the ‘Hate Story’ franchise, this one filled with love, romance, sex, betrayal, back-stabbing, revenge and suspense.

Hate Story 3 begins with the inauguration of ‘Vikram Dewan Memorial Hospital’ at the hands of Aditya Singh Dewan (Sharman Joshi) & Siya Singh Dewan (Zareen Khan) to establish that Aditya Dewan and Siya Dewan are large hearted philanthropists.

But the fact is otherwise as even once Siya is questioned of getting married to the younger brother of the person she was in love.

Goa Governor Mridula Sinha at K KH G – 21st Century screening

A 50 year old uneducated man rises from ashes to glory with the help and support of seven year old boy. Filmy Town reveals the gist of K..Kh..G..21st Century, which is produced by Shakuntala Art & Creations

The Governor of Goa, Mridula Sinha is also a renowned writer in Hindi Literature. Even after her marriage, she pursued a post-graduate degree in Psychology. She, along with her husband were interested in serving the poor and the uneducated, rather than in making money. The couple therefore settled at Motihari, a remote and under-developed East Champaran District of Bihar.

Speaking to Filmy Town, the story, screenplay and dialogue writer, Mukesh Kumar Malo said, “‘K Kh G… 21st Century’ is an edutainment (education through entertaining medium) film depicting the importance and value of education for a common man. After watching it the viewer would say “padhna likhna jaruri hai ” (being literate is must or education is must!)

The movie shows the journey of a commoner, who is exploited due to his illiteracy and ignorance. The shattered truck driver is given a hope to survive by a bright and confident seven year old boy. The child educates him and equips him with the power of knowledge to assert his rights and win back his pride and property. His quest for knowledge doesn’t end here….

We are blessed that a such a noble personality attended our film screening and encouraged us”, said Bipin Vinayak who plays the protagonist ‘Buddhan’ in the acclaimed film, covered by Filmy Town, which held its special preview on on 24th November 2015 at the NFDC Film Bazaar in Goa.
